I'm not sure where to start with this problem which is the reason for this
post! I have a small test cluster setup and not a lot of experience yet..
After rebooting the servers (via reboot cmd) I am no longer able to mount
the FS from any of the servers where I previously could.
When I try to mount the FS I receive the following error.
'mount -t lustre 1.1.1.1 at tcp0:/lustre /mnt/lustre'
mount.lustre: mount 1.1.1.1 at tcp0:/lustre at /mnt/lustre failed: No such
device
Are the lustre modules loaded?
Check /etc/modprobe.conf and /proc/filesystems
Note 'alias lustre llite' should be removed from modprobe.conf
